If a hospital provides trauma care for both adult and pediatric patients, the Level designation may not be the same for each group. A secondary hospital, also known as a secondary referral center or secondary care center, is a hospital in the United States that may provide licensed doctors in pediatrics, obstetrics and gynecology, general surgery, and other medical services. Level II Trauma Centers provide 24-hour urgent coverage by general surgeons, as well as coverage by orthopedic surgery, neurosurgery, anesthesia, emergency medicine, radiography, and critical care specialists. If a surgical resident is in the hospital 24-hours a day, then the attending surgeon can take call from outside the hospital but must be able to respond within 15 minutes. The American College of Surgeons also note that in level 1 trauma centers, the director of the intensive care unit (ICU) must be a surgeon with a current board certification in surgical critical care. Pediatric trauma surgery is its own speciality and adult trauma surgeons are not generally specialized in providing surgical trauma care to children, and vice versa. A total of 1154 adult trauma centers were identified in the 50 states and the District of Columbia, including 190 level I and 263 level II centers (Table 1). Level III Criteria are adopted by reference into Iowa Administrative Code from the Resources for the Optimal Care of the Injured Patient 2014 (American College of Surgeons Committee on Trauma, 2014) 12 III A Level III trauma center must have continuous general surgical coverage (CD 2 12).
